[討論] Leader都把程式碼進到master

看板Soft_Job作者 (西部のカニ)時間6月前 (2023/10/08 03:00), 6月前編輯推噓61(687195)
留言270則, 92人參與, 6月前最新討論串1/1
幫學弟問,原文照 po: 「我在台灣某網通大廠,第一份工作 leader 都把master 當自己的 branch 進 code 不用別人 review 常常把自己不能動的 code 推進去 或是偷偷改 lib 都不講 code進了不能跑,還被說效率不好 反應了也會被罵 平常會叫我去解釋 PR 寫了什麼 前陣子還要我教他 python decorator 是什麼 現在也會把 venv 跟 vm 的檔案推上去 每次 commit 都幾千個檔案 講了也被罵 有次我週五請病假 結果他晚上打電話來說要code review 跟我說以為是小病,沒差 他一直說業界都這樣做事 請問板上大大,真的是這樣嗎 」 -- Sent from nPTT on my -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 111.241.140.209 (臺灣) ※ 文章網址: https://www.ptt.cc/bbs/Soft_Job/M.1696705235.A.79E.html

10/08 03:11, 6月前 , 1F
這種能做到leader,還不逃?
10/08 03:11, 1F

10/08 03:41, 6月前 , 2F
看起來你們沒有code review系統 也沒有CICD
10/08 03:41, 2F

10/08 03:45, 6月前 , 3F
雖然有導入可能也會沒開設定 還是可以自己進code
10/08 03:45, 3F

10/08 03:57, 6月前 , 4F
塊陶
10/08 03:57, 4F

10/08 04:08, 6月前 , 5F
這該不會也是你leader的第一份吧
10/08 04:08, 5F

10/08 04:19, 6月前 , 6F
切記 業界沒有這樣
10/08 04:19, 6F

10/08 04:21, 6月前 , 7F
正常公司不會這樣 這種只能靠你自立自強
10/08 04:21, 7F

10/08 04:21, 6月前 , 8F
外商也有這種 程度沒到大學畢業的
10/08 04:21, 8F

10/08 04:51, 6月前 , 9F
有些人單純嘴砲能力上位的
10/08 04:51, 9F

10/08 04:52, 6月前 , 10F
勸你還是快閃
10/08 04:52, 10F

10/08 04:54, 6月前 , 11F
不懂技術不一定是問題 但不懂卻碰技術就是問題
10/08 04:54, 11F

10/08 05:25, 6月前 , 12F
奇文觀賞
10/08 05:25, 12F

10/08 05:26, 6月前 , 13F
每個業界都這樣幹那還得了
10/08 05:26, 13F

10/08 05:28, 6月前 , 14F
平衡推
10/08 05:28, 14F

10/08 05:29, 6月前 , 15F
順便偷問一下是哪一間
10/08 05:29, 15F

10/08 06:32, 6月前 , 16F
快逃
10/08 06:32, 16F

10/08 07:35, 6月前 , 17F
我碰過類似的,做三個月果斷烙跑
10/08 07:35, 17F

10/08 07:41, 6月前 , 18F
Jenkins gerrit 這種免費的CICD自己串一串不會?這種組
10/08 07:41, 18F

10/08 07:41, 6月前 , 19F
內自己就可以搞定的,覺得看不慣就自己建流程是多難?
10/08 07:41, 19F

10/08 07:44, 6月前 , 20F
製造業正常啦
10/08 07:44, 20F

10/08 07:44, 6月前 , 21F
全部都要等到公司準備好,那事情就不用做了
10/08 07:44, 21F

10/08 07:49, 6月前 , 22F
建一個integration test 讓你主管不能推有問題的扣
10/08 07:49, 22F

10/08 07:49, 6月前 , 23F
上去啊
10/08 07:49, 23F

10/08 08:03, 6月前 , 24F
我認真回答你~你主管滿鳥的~他在科技業主管群裡的pr大概
10/08 08:03, 24F

10/08 08:03, 6月前 , 25F
只有25
10/08 08:03, 25F

10/08 08:32, 6月前 , 26F
拉出一個dev/release, 放棄已經存在的master讓他玩沙
10/08 08:32, 26F

10/08 08:46, 6月前 , 27F
好奇是哪一間
10/08 08:46, 27F

10/08 08:58, 6月前 , 28F
不是業界 是三流系統廠
10/08 08:58, 28F

10/08 09:01, 6月前 , 29F
這樣pr還有25喔
10/08 09:01, 29F

10/08 09:36, 6月前 , 30F
有些leader根本連code都不會寫,確實有pr25
10/08 09:36, 30F

10/08 09:53, 6月前 , 31F
嗯,一個字跑
10/08 09:53, 31F

10/08 10:02, 6月前 , 32F
有 一定有更爛的主管幫原文說的這位稱到25 XD
10/08 10:02, 32F

10/08 10:03, 6月前 , 33F
我之前隔壁組~空降一個鳥主管到今年初2年半~底下的人換了
10/08 10:03, 33F

10/08 10:03, 6月前 , 34F
一輪半~最後他的主管職位被他老闆拔掉~最後兩位從他手底
10/08 10:03, 34F

10/08 10:04, 6月前 , 35F
轉組的人跟主管的主管說: 爛死了這甚麼主管?怎麼選的?
10/08 10:04, 35F

10/08 10:04, 6月前 , 36F
那你說原文這位老闆有沒有PR25?
10/08 10:04, 36F

10/08 10:29, 6月前 , 37F
沒有code review就算了,跑不動的代碼竟然能進到mast
10/08 10:29, 37F

10/08 10:29, 6月前 , 38F
er?世界奇觀
10/08 10:29, 38F

10/08 10:38, 6月前 , 39F
真可怕= =
10/08 10:38, 39F
還有 192 則推文
還有 2 段內文
10/11 20:51, 6月前 , 232F
rar...浪費空間和開發效率0
10/11 20:51, 232F

10/11 21:19, 6月前 , 233F
這有什麼 我待過的外商 leader連local 和remote分枝都分
10/11 21:19, 233F

10/11 21:19, 6月前 , 234F
不清楚
10/11 21:19, 234F

10/12 07:04, 6月前 , 235F
peter98閱讀能力與邏輯能力才有問題。有人在用master分支
10/12 07:04, 235F

10/12 07:04, 6月前 , 236F
,與master分支是不是release分支有什麼關系
10/12 07:04, 236F

10/12 07:06, 6月前 , 237F
不懂git的人別來嘴別人啦。git 從來就沒有標準在規定某個
10/12 07:06, 237F

10/12 07:06, 6月前 , 238F
分支不能暫存開發程式碼。
10/12 07:06, 238F

10/12 07:07, 6月前 , 239F
即使master或main分支,也絕對可以暫存開發程式碼。因為該
10/12 07:07, 239F

10/12 07:08, 6月前 , 240F
分支不一定會Release。事實就是如此。
10/12 07:08, 240F

10/12 07:08, 6月前 , 241F
歡迎提出合理證據討論。
10/12 07:08, 241F

10/12 07:11, 6月前 , 242F
git也沒規定,兩人開發同一分支,不能暫存自己程式碼。本
10/12 07:11, 242F

10/12 07:11, 6月前 , 243F
來就可以。尤其是該分支的所有者不是你,你根本沒資格管別
10/12 07:11, 243F

10/12 07:11, 6月前 , 244F
人要存什麼程式碼。這才是git 設計的精神。你可以任意管別
10/12 07:11, 244F

10/12 07:11, 6月前 , 245F
人開的分支,才是不合理的。
10/12 07:11, 245F

10/12 07:13, 6月前 , 246F
master有別人用,有你用又怎麼樣?你不是所有者,你根本沒
10/12 07:13, 246F

10/12 07:13, 6月前 , 247F
資格管別人怎麼管理master程式碼。
10/12 07:13, 247F

10/12 07:22, 6月前 , 248F
我絕對認同該主管有問題,快逃,但問題不在使用git的方式
10/12 07:22, 248F

10/12 07:22, 6月前 , 249F
10/12 07:22, 249F

10/12 07:24, 6月前 , 250F
以上別斷章取義在戰別人了。
10/12 07:24, 250F

10/12 15:48, 6月前 , 251F
原PO只寫到原PO自己和主管有用,沒講到同事有沒有抱怨
10/12 15:48, 251F

10/12 15:48, 6月前 , 252F
說不定master真的是那主管專用的
10/12 15:48, 252F
回應一下,master就是release用,但leader把master自己開發中的程式碼都push上去。當l eader寫完,會在群組喊聲叫大家要git clone新版。大概就是當FTP的概念。 ※ 編輯: SaibuKani (49.218.88.36 臺灣), 10/12/2023 18:11:53

10/12 21:46, 6月前 , 253F
在垃圾公司的通常都是….
10/12 21:46, 253F

10/12 21:46, 6月前 , 254F
你行就是你當主管了,為什麼你還是……
10/12 21:46, 254F

10/13 04:35, 6月前 , 255F
所謂的release用,有到master上的每個commit?
10/13 04:35, 255F

10/13 04:40, 6月前 , 256F
這回應還是沒講到release(給客戶/下個phase),沒CICD的話很
10/13 04:40, 256F

10/13 04:40, 6月前 , 257F
多用板控真的只是當有log的FTP在用啊
10/13 04:40, 257F

10/13 08:35, 6月前 , 258F
當FTP在用 然後其他員工被搞得很麻煩 離職真的比較快
10/13 08:35, 258F

10/13 15:38, 6月前 , 259F
其實master就只是一個branch,沒什麼了不起的
10/13 15:38, 259F

10/13 15:40, 6月前 , 260F
不過你應該是想抱怨他愛release就release,沒有任何的管
10/13 15:40, 260F

10/13 15:40, 6月前 , 261F
控,但這是制度問題
10/13 15:40, 261F

10/13 15:43, 6月前 , 262F
你可以跳出來「老闆你別寫扣了,你負責review就好」然後
10/13 15:43, 262F

10/13 15:43, 6月前 , 263F
把他技術面架空後,再導入機制
10/13 15:43, 263F

10/13 21:52, 6月前 , 264F
遇到這種你還不快跑
10/13 21:52, 264F

10/13 23:47, 6月前 , 265F
南港某耳機公司裡面也很多SW leader這樣
10/13 23:47, 265F

10/13 23:48, 6月前 , 266F
自己不會 叫RD教 然後聽不懂 還罵RD 這種人也有
10/13 23:48, 266F

10/15 02:30, 6月前 , 267F
叫他吃屎
10/15 02:30, 267F

10/15 20:37, 6月前 , 268F
git clone是哪招,每一次打掉重練開新repo叫大家複製嗎
10/15 20:37, 268F

10/17 03:14, 6月前 , 269F
主流git管理就那幾套各有試用環境 打迷糊仗說想怎樣就怎
10/17 03:14, 269F

10/17 03:15, 6月前 , 270F
樣乾脆自己接案就好 愛怎樣管都憑個人喜好
10/17 03:15, 270F
文章代碼(AID): #1b8QhJUU (Soft_Job)